새로운 모습으로 다시 돌아오겠습니다
북트레싱
  • 홈
  • 세컨드 브레인
  • 책 추천
  • 책 리뷰
  • 자기계발
  • 독서 관련 팁
  • 소식&이벤트
북트레싱
  • 홈
  • 세컨드 브레인
  • 책 추천
  • 책 리뷰
  • 자기계발
  • 독서 관련 팁
  • 소식&이벤트
No Result
View All Result
북트레싱
No Result
View All Result
  • 홈
  • 세컨드 브레인
  • 책 추천
  • 책 리뷰
  • 자기계발
  • 독서 관련 팁
  • 소식&이벤트
Home 책 리뷰

옵시디언 대시보드, MOC 만들기

북트레싱 by 북트레싱
2월 15, 2024
in 책 리뷰
A A
0

Table of Contents

  • 1. 홈페이지를 만드는 방법 Dashboard
  • 2. 대시보드 만드는 방법
  • 3. 옵시디언 대시보드(MOC) 만들기
  • 4. 대시보드 노트 만들기
  • 5. 데이터뷰 인라인 쿼리 사용
  • 6. 대시보드 페이지 작성 예시
  • 7. dashboard.css 파일
  • 8. homepage 플러그인

1 홈페이지를 만드는 방법 Dashboard

옵시디언 대시보드를 만들고 홈페이지로 지정하는 방법에 대해서 다루겠습니다.
대시보드는 MOC 즉 Map of content 라고 부르기도 하고, 인덱스 페이지, 홈페이지 등으로 불리기도 합니다.

대시보드를 만들어서 홈페이지로 지정하거나 대시보드의 노트 링크 안에 대시보드를 추가로 작성하여 입체적인 지식 관리가 가능합니다.

우리가 꼭 기억해야 할 중요한 일이 있을 때 “염두에 둔다” 라는 표현을 자주 사용하듯이 옵시디언에서도 현재 진행중인 프로젝트의 노트 또는, 단기간에 완성하지 못하는 노트가 있다면 그것을 홈페이지에 두고, 단축키 또는 간단히 아이콘을 클릭하는 것 만으로도 접근이 가능하도록 만들 수 있습니다.

옵시디언 대시보드 MOC

2 대시보드 만드는 방법

3 옵시디언 대시보드(MOC) 만들기

대시보드를 작성하고 적용하기 위해서는 CSS 스니펫을 적용시켜줘야 합니다.
이는 커뮤니티 플러그인을 설치했던 방법과 차이가 있습니다.

옵시디언 CSS 적용

먼저 사용하는 볼트가 저장된 폴더 내의 .obsidian → snippets에 .css 파일을 저장을 먼저 해주신 다음에, 옵시디언 [설정] – [테마]에서 CSS 스니펫에서 활성화를 시켜줘야 합니다.

4 대시보드 노트 만들기

가장 새 노트를 만들어주고, 노트의 제목은 자유롭게 만들어 주면 되고, 예시에서는 Home 이라고 만들었습니다.
대시보드 CSS의 원활한 작동을 위해서 반드시 카테고리의 제목은 heading 2로 입력을 해주셔야 합니다.

그리고 그 아래에 리스트를 만들어 섹션 이름을 지정하고, 하위 항목으로 노트들의 링크를 삽입할 수 있습니다.

옵시디언 대시보드, MOC 만들기

5 데이터뷰 인라인 쿼리 사용

대시보드의 아래 부분은 특정한 노트의 리스트를 볼 수 있는 카테고리를 만들었습니다.
여기에서는 데이터뷰 플러그인의 인라인 쿼리를 사용하여 작성을 하였습니다.

하나를 살펴보면 최근 수정한 노트 5개를 가져오는 쿼리인데, 기본적으로 아래를 응용하여 바꿀 수 있습니다.

`$=dv.list(dv.pages(”).sort(f=>f.file.mtime.ts,”desc”).limit(5).file.link)`

폴더를 지정하기 위해서는 pages(“)에 넣어주시면 되고, desc(내림차순)은 ase(오름차순)으로 변경하실 수 있습니다.
그리고 limit뒤의 괄호 안의 숫자는 대시보드에 보여줄 노트의 개수를 의미합니다.

6 대시보드 페이지 작성 예시

---
cssclasses: dashboard
---

## 독서
- 📗 현재 읽고 있는 책
 - [[노트1]]
 - [[노트2]]
- 📕 앞으로 읽을 책
 - [[노트3]]
 - [[노트4]]
- 📘 독서 노트
 - [[독서 노트 작성]]

## 학습
- 💻 코딩 공부
 - [[자바스크립트 기초]]
 - [[파이썬 기초]]
- 💜 옵시디언
 - [[Dataview 플러그인]]
 - [[Templater 플러그인]]

## 유튜브
- 🗒 기획
 - [[03_옵시디언 꾸미기]]
- 🎥 촬영
 - [[02_CSS 적용하기]]
- 🖥 편집
 - [[01_플러그인 활용]]

## 노트 리스트
- 🗃 최근 수정한 노트
  `$=dv.list(dv.pages('').sort(f=>f.file.mtime.ts,"desc").limit(5).file.link)`
- 📝 최근 작성한 노트
  `$=dv.list(dv.pages('').sort(f=>f.file.ctime.ts,"desc").limit(5).file.link)`
- 📁 폴더: 폴더명
  `$=dv.list(dv.pages('"폴더명"').sort(f=>f.file.ctime.ts,"desc").limit(5).file.link)`
- 🔖 태그: 태그명
  `$=dv.list(dv.pages('#태그명').sort(f=>f.file.name,"desc").limit(5).file.link)`
- ✅ 완료: 프로젝트
  `$=dv.list(dv.pages('').where(p => p.source === "값").sort(f=>f.file.name, "asc").limit(5).file.link)`

7 dashboard.css 파일

Dashboard.css 파일 다운로드

위 링크에 접속하여 아래 그림에서 표시된 버튼을 눌러서 다운로드 받을 수 있습니다.

옵시디언 대시보드, MOC 만들기

8 homepage 플러그인

대시보드로 지정할 노트의 작성을 완성한 다음은 ‘homepage’라는 커뮤니티 플러그인을 사용하여 옵시디언의 Home 화면으로 사용할 수 있습니다.이렇게 완성을 해봤는데요.
이제 작성한 노트를 홈페이지로 지정을 해 주어야 합니다.

[옵션]에서 open when empty를 활성화시켜 주게 되면 옵시디언의 모든 탭을 닫아도 홈 화면이 유지가 됩니다.
그리고 ‘Opened view’는 기본으로 Default view로 설정이 되어 있지만 dashboard.css 파일을 사용하려면 reading view로 변경하고 사용해야 합니다.

Tags: CSS 적용옵시디언 MOC옵시디언 대시보드옵시디언 홈화면인덱스 노트
Previous Post

옵시디언 책 정보 수집 플러그인, korean book info 커스텀

Next Post

옵시디언 콜아웃 사용법 멀티 칼럼 모듈러 CSS 적용

관련 글 더 읽기

에고라는-적

에고라는 적 요약 리뷰, 자의식을 해체하라

by 북트레싱
1월 17, 2024
0

저자는 인생을 크게 3단계인 ‘열망’-‘성공’-‘실패’의 단계로 나누고 있습니다. 이 단계들에서 ‘에고라는 적’은 항상 함께하고 우리 삶에 부정적인 영향을 미친다고 설명하며 그 해결책을 제시합니다.

10배의-법칙-그랜트-카돈

10배의 법칙 리뷰, 요약 – 그랜트 카돈

by 북트레싱
1월 17, 2024
0

저자인 그랜트 카돈은 최고의 영업 트레이자 마케팅 능력을 지닌 인물로 최근에는 '집착의 법칙'을 출간하며 다시 한 번 화제가 되었습니다. 집착의 법칙을 출간하기 전 2011년 출간된 이 책, '10배의 법칙' 책에서는...

결국-해내는-사람들의-원칙

결국 해내는 사람들의 원칙 리뷰, 100% 목표 달성하는 방법

by 북트레싱
1월 17, 2024
0

결국 해내는 사람들의 원칙 제목부터 꼭 읽어야겠다는 생각이 들만한 책입니다. 성공이라는 의미가 각자 모두에게 다르겠지만 우리는 성공하기 위해서 하루하루를 열심히 살아가고 있습니다. 결국 해내는 사람들의 원칙은 성공으로 가는 길에 필요한...

빠르게-실패하기

실패가 두려운 당신에게, 빠르게 실패하기

by 북트레싱
1월 17, 2024
0

보통 '실패'라는 단어는 부정적인 의미를 지니고만 있다고 생각하고, 실패는 하면 안되는 걸로 인식합니다. 하지만 '빠르게 실패하기'의 저자는 실패에 대한 두려움이 우리의 삶을 지루하고 답답하게 만들 수 있다고 말하며, 이를 극복하기...

Load More
Next Post
옵시디언 콜아웃 멀티 칼럼

옵시디언 콜아웃 사용법 멀티 칼럼 모듈러 CSS 적용

옵시디언 할 일 관리를 캘린더 tasks 플러그인

옵시디언 할 일 관리를 캘린더 tasks 플러그인

옵시디언 지도 위치 표시

옵시디언 지도 위치 표시, 커스텀 지도 만들기 Map View

옵시디언 파일 복구 스냅샷

옵시디언 파일 복구하기 스냅샷 기능

Mac homebrew 홈브류 설치

맥(Mac OS) Homebrew(홈브류)를 통한 Node.js 및 파이썬 설치

Leave Comment

태그

node.js (2) python (2) todoist api 토큰 (1) 갤러리뷰 (1) 계획 (2) 다이어리 (1) 데일리 노트 예시 (1) 데일리 노트 코드 소스 (1) 데일리 노트 템플릿 (1) 두려움 (2) 메모 (2) 메타인지 (2) 목표 (6) 목표달성 (4) 목표설정 (3) 베스트셀러 (7) 생산성 (3) 성공 (3) 세컨드브레인 (4) 습관기르기 (2) 습관 기르기 (1) 습관끊기 (2) 습관만들기 (2) 실패 (3) 연간 계획 (1) 옵시디언 (2) 옵시디언 todoist 사용법 (1) 옵시디언 데일리 노트 (1) 옵시디언 테마 (1) 옵시디언 투두이스트 연동 (1) 옵시디언 플러그인 (2) 월간 노트 (1) 자기계발 (12) 자바스크립트 (2) 지식관리 (4) 카드뷰 (1) 템플레이터 (1) 템플릿 예시 (1) 템플릿 플러그인 (1) 투두리스트 (2) 투두이스트 api (1) 파이썬 (2) 플래너 (1) 할일 달력 (1) 행동 (2)

키워드 검색

No Result
View All Result

구독하기

  • About Us
  • Blog
  • Contact Us
  • Disclosure
  • Home
  • Privacy Policy
  • Terms Of Use

Copyright 2024. Booktracing. All rights reserved. / 상호명 : 인사이트웨이브 / 사업자등록번호 : 636-22-01756

Welcome Back!

Login to your account below

Forgotten Password?

Retrieve your password

Please enter your username or email address to reset your password.

Log In
No Result
View All Result
  • About Us
  • Blog
  • Contact Us
  • Disclosure
  • Home
  • Privacy Policy
  • Terms Of Use

Copyright 2024. Booktracing. All rights reserved. / 상호명 : 인사이트웨이브 / 사업자등록번호 : 636-22-01756

This website uses cookies. By continuing to use this website you are giving consent to cookies being used. Visit our Privacy and Cookie Policy.